CONSTITUTION AND BY-LAWS

of the

SOUTH DAKOTA BANDMASTERS ASSOCIATION

CONSTITUTION

ARTICLE I - Name

  1. This organization shall be known as the South Dakota Bandmasters Association

ARTICLE II - Object

  1. The object of this organization shall be:

  1. To promote mutual cooperation, friendship, and fellowship among the band directors of the State of South Dakota.

  2. To cooperate with and aid any other music association.

  3. To make suggestions and to recommend measures for the welfare of its members.

  4. To promote a free exchange of ideas.

  5. To improve the professional efficiency of its members.

  6. To encourage a genuine spirit of professional ethics.

  7. To work in close cooperation with school administrators in order that the program of the South Dakota Bandmasters Association will be in harmony with the school program as a whole.

  8. To do all possible to raise the standard of music in all forms in South Dakota.

  9. To further the development of music in the schools and school systems of South Dakota.

ARTICLE III - Membership

  1. Active membership shall include:

  1. Any bandmaster or person actively engaged in directing or teaching music.

  1. Associate membership shall include:

  1. Interested parties who do not meet the qualifications of active membership, such as:

    1. Music publishing firms.

    2. Musical instrument manufacturing companies.

    3. Music dealers or their representative.

  1. Honorary membership shall include:

    1. Former active members retired from directing bands or teaching music.

    2. Any other eminent bandmaster or other musician, who has:

      1. Contributed in a noteworthy manner to the advancement of bands or band literature or music in the State of South Dakota.

      2. Been elected to honorary membership by the members of the South Dakota Bandmasters Association.

ARTICLE IV - Officers

  1. The officers of the South Dakota Bandmasters Association shall consist of a President, a President-Elect, a Secretary-Treasurer, and four Board members. These officers, plus the immediate Past-President, shall constitute the Executive Board.

  2. The President, the President-elect, the Secretary-Treasurer, and two Board members shall be elected at the annual business meeting that falls on odd-numbered years.

  3. All officers shall take office immediately after the adjournment of the business meeting in which they were elected. Board members shall hold office four years, with two retiring every off-numbered year. All officers shall hold office for two years, or until their successors shall be elected and qualified.

ARTICLE V - Meetings

  1. The South Dakota Bandmasters Association shall meet annually at such time and place as may be selected at the annual meeting or as may be selected by the Executive Board

  2. The Executive Board shall have charge of all business appertaining to the Association and its members between meetings which, in the judgment of the President, cannot wait until the next meeting of the Association.

  3. All meetings of this Association shall be governed by Robert's Rules of Order. The representative of the South Dakota High School Activities Association shall serve as parliamentarian for each meeting.

  4. A quorum for the annual business meeting shall consist of the members present. A quorum for the Executive Board shall consist of four members.

  5. The order of business at regular meetings shall be:

  1. Roll call of officers.

  2. Reading of minutes of last regular meeting and any special meetings.

  3. Report of the Secretary-Treasurer.

  4. Reports from Standing Committees.

  5. Reports from Special Committees.

  6. Reports of sickness or distress.

  7. Communications.

  8. Unfinished business.

  9. New business.

  10. Selection of annual meeting site and date.

  11. Good of the Association

  12. Election of officers (odd years) or nominating committee (even years).

  13. Adjournment.

ARTICLE VI - Elections

  1. Election of Association Officers shall be held during the annual business meeting that falls on odd-numbered years.

  2. Election of a Nominating Committee shall be held during the annual business meeting that falls on even-numbered years. The member receiving the largest number of votes shall serve as chairman of the committee. The Nominating Committee shall consist of five members.

  3. The Nominating Committee shall present a minimum of two candidates for each of the two Board positions, a minimum of two candidates for President-Elect, and one candidate for Secretary-Treasurer.

  4. Board members shall be nominated and elected to facilitate representation from all parts of the state according to the present State Music Regions. Each Board members shall be chosen from and shall represent two regions. One member shall represent Regions I and II, Regions III and IV, Regions V and VI, and Regions VII and VIII.

  5. Additional nominations may be made from the floor for any office.

  6. Voting shall be by secret ballot.

ARTICLE VII - Amendments

  1. The Constitution of the South Dakota Bandmasters Association may be amended in the following manner:

  1. The proposed amendment must have received the approval of the Executive Board prior to being brought to the membership.

  2. Formal notice of the proposed amendment must be made available to the membership twelve hours before it is to be voted upon.

  3. The proposed amendment must receive two-thirds approval from the members present at the annual business meeting where the vote is held.

ARTICLE VIII - By-Laws

  1. Any motion passed at a regular business meeting of the Association which provides for a permanent practice shall be dated and become a part of the By-Laws and, therefore, filed and permanently preserved.

  2. By-Laws may be adopted by the members of the Association at any regular business meeting to amend previous By-Laws, and when adopted will automatically nullify any previous by-Laws of the Association which are in conflict with the same.
